标签: windows-phone-7
我需要某种后台工作,它会自动检查网络可用性并同步隔离存储中存在的数据,并且当我的应用程序运行时,此作业应该并行运行,并且应该每隔30秒运行一次。 请提供一些建议。我尝试过定期任务,但每30分钟只运行一次。
答案 0 :(得分:2)
如果您希望在应用程序运行时定期执行某些代码,则可以以30秒的间隔使用DispatchTimer。
DispatchTimer
但为什么要定期检查网络连接?您应该只执行需要连接的任何代码,并使用try / catch块处理任何与网络相关的错误。